What companies run services between Coventry, England and Champneys Henlow, England?

You can take a train from Coventry to Champneys Henlow via London Euston, London St Pancras Intl, and Arlesey in around 2h 27m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Pool Meadow Bus Station to Champneys Henlow via Milton Keynes Coachway, Bus Station, and The Crown - West in around 4h 8m.
